Geoffrey Peters is a pioneering otolaryngologist whose work has redefined the surgical management of complex salivary gland disorders. His research centers on minimally invasive, robotic-assisted techniques for treating conditions like sialolithiasis and oral ranulas, offering patients alternatives to traditional, more invasive gland resection. Peters’ major contributions include demonstrating the feasibility and precision of the da Vinci Surgical System in the transoral removal of submandibular megaliths—stones exceeding 8 mm—and bilateral floor-of-mouth ranulas. His landmark 2010 paper on robotic-assisted submandibular megalith removal (38 citations) established a novel combined approach that spares the gland, while his 2011 study on bilateral ranula excision (26 citations) highlighted the advantages of robotic assistance in accessing challenging oral anatomy. Though his citation counts reflect a focused, early-career impact, Peters’ work is notable for pushing the boundaries of transoral robotic surgery (TORS) into salivary gland pathology, a domain traditionally dominated by open surgery. His case reports serve as foundational references for surgeons seeking to expand TORS applications, ultimately improving patient outcomes by reducing morbidity and preserving gland function.
